How Tor Browser Works on the Dark Web

Tor Browser encrypts your data and sends it through at least three randomly selected relays before reaching its destination. Each relay decrypts one layer of encryption, revealing only the next relay's address. The exit node sees outgoing traffic but not your identity. This three-hop structure is why Tor provides meaningful anonymity compared to standard browsers. When you access a .onion address, the connection stays entirely within the Tor network—no exit node is involved. The best dark web browser maintains this architecture consistently. Circuit rotation happens automatically; Tor Browser builds a new path every 10 minutes for new connections. Understanding this process helps you recognize when something isn't working correctly. If your browser connects directly to a website without routing through Tor, anonymity is lost immediately.

Step-by-Step Installation and Setup

Download Tor Browser only from the official Tor Project website to avoid compromised versions. Verify the signature if you're on Linux or macOS. Extract the archive to a folder of your choice—no installation wizard is required. Launch the application and wait for it to connect to the Tor network; this takes 30 seconds to two minutes depending on your connection. Once connected, the onion icon in the address bar turns solid. Test your setup by visiting a Tor-checking website to confirm your IP is hidden. Do not maximize the browser window to its full screen size—this can make fingerprinting easier. Keep Tor Browser updated; security patches are released regularly. Create a separate user account on your computer for Tor browsing if you handle sensitive work. Never run other applications while using Tor Browser, as they may leak your real IP address.

Accessing .Onion Addresses Safely

Onion addresses are 56-character strings ending in .onion, designed to be accessed only through Tor. They're not indexed by search engines and must be shared directly or found through directories. Before visiting an .onion site, verify the address multiple times—typos lead to phishing sites. Use the Tor Browser's built-in security level; set it to Standard unless you have a specific reason to lower it. Disable JavaScript on untrusted sites by using the security slider. Many .onion services are legitimate: news outlets, privacy organizations, and communication platforms operate there. Others host illegal content or scams. Assume any marketplace or service asking for payment could be a scam. Do not enable browser extensions on .onion sites. If a site requests your real email address or personal information, reconsider whether you should be there. The best dark web browser approach is cautious skepticism—verify before trusting.

Frequently asked questions

Is Tor Browser legal to use?

Yes, Tor Browser is legal in most countries. It's maintained by a nonprofit organization and used by journalists, activists, and privacy-conscious people worldwide. Some countries restrict or monitor Tor usage, but possession and use are not inherently illegal. Using Tor for illegal activities remains illegal regardless of the tool.

Can my ISP see that I'm using Tor?

Your ISP can see that you're connecting to Tor entry nodes, but not your destination or activity. Using a VPN before Tor hides this fact from your ISP. Tor bridges can further obscure Tor usage. In countries where Tor is monitored, combining a VPN with Tor provides additional cover.

What's the difference between the dark web and the deep web?

The deep web includes any part of the internet not indexed by search engines—email accounts, medical records, paywalled content. The dark web is a small part of the deep web intentionally hidden and accessible only through Tor or similar networks. Most of the deep web is mundane; the dark web is where anonymity is the primary feature.
